Genetic variation was found between isolates of Botrytis elliptica from the
USA and Taiwan based on 22 polymorphic markers from five RAPID primers. Am
ong these 69 isolates, there were 43 different genotypes. One clonal genoty
pe was found spanning Oregon and Washington, USA, and in a population from
Hsinshe, Taiwan, clonal genotypes were frequent, demonstrating the importan
ce of asexual spread of this pathogen. However, when only unique genotypes
were considered, gametic disequilibrium among putative RAPD loci of the gen
otypes from Taiwan (33) or Hsinshe (23) was not detected, suggesting an und
erlying sexual recombination system for this population of B. elliptica. A
weak level of cultivar specialization was defected among B. elliptica isola
tes from the Hsinshe population based on analysis of genetic distances betw
een isolates.
